I am currently in the process of doing a full renovation on a building in Santa Fe, New Mexico for an art gallery. Built in 1932 (with later additions), the building is adobe and was originally used a community grocery store. Over 3,000 square feet of concrete and wood floor where removed the past few weeks. One of the guys discovered this old bicycle fender in the soil! After the fender, for days I had visions of finding a discarded Indian or HD! But alas, the only thing good found was this batch of old discarded beer cans. :(
